Weather and Climate in Mansfield
Seasonal Temperatures: Mansfield has a typical summer high of 81°F and a winter low of 15°F. And the yearly rainfall here is about 37 inches, while the snowfall is around 40 inch(es) on average.
Air Quality: The Average air quality index rating is usually 82, which is higher than the national average of 58.The index rating at or below 100 is considered satisfactory.

Common Home Care Services
The usual home care services or facilities may be different depending on the specific needs of the retired individual receiving care. However, some regular services offered by home care providers that include ass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, grooming, and toileting. Medication management, including reminders to take medications and meal preparation with feeding assistance.

There are as many as 5 means to pay for home care services for seniors. They include:
Private pay options (out of pocket payments)
Paying by yourself is the most usual method of payment. However, it's not a simple decision to adopt. To pay, you may have to use your funds or dispose of some of your other property. Nonetheless, it's typical to take this route to cover such costs.
Long-Term Care Insurance (LTCI)
Long-term care insurance (LTCI) is often an remarkable resource to pay for home care. However, exercise caution that not all LTCI plans are the same. Some may not take care of all your expenses; therefore, talk to your insurance provider and obtain particulars in advance.
Private health insurance
There are several personal health insurances accessible for older adults to enroll in. They vary from state to state. Thus, it is advisable to look into your state page on our website and confirm specific home care payment choices.
VA benefits
The U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s grants veterans VA Aid & Attendance benefits. Verify if you are entitled for them. To be eligible for VA Aid & Attendance privileges for home care, veterans must meet distinct standards including having a service-connected disability or being unable to leave their home due to a health condition. If you are, this pension can cover a substantial amount of your Home Care payments. Visit the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s website to get comprehensive information.
